What Gulf Coast Storms Do to a Roof
Meyerland sits squarely in the path of Houston's severe weather. Straight-line winds crease and peel shingles, hail hammers the surface and knocks granules loose, and wind-driven rain forces water under anything that is not perfectly sealed. Because our storms drop heavy rain fast, even minor damage can turn into an active leak within one wet week.
Damage we routinely find after a storm includes:
- Bruised or fractured shingles where hail struck
- Granule loss that leaves the asphalt mat exposed
- Creased, torn, or missing shingles from high wind
- Dented vents, flashing, and gutters
- Loosened flashing at chimneys, walls, and valleys
- Leaks showing up as attic or ceiling stains
Why Damage Is Easy to Miss
Hail bruising often does not leak right away. The impact weakens the shingle and strips its protective granules, and the failure shows up months later as the exposed mat breaks down under UV and rain. That delay is why a storm that "looked fine" from the driveway can still cost you a roof. A close, on-roof inspection is the only reliable way to know.
